How to prepare for a job interview at North Oak Recruitment
✨Know Your Numbers
As an Assistant Financial Planner, you’ll need to demonstrate your understanding of financial concepts and metrics. Brush up on key financial ratios, investment strategies, and market trends relevant to the role. Being able to discuss these confidently will show that you’re not just a candidate, but a knowledgeable asset.
✨Showcase Client-Centric Thinking
This company prides itself on putting clients at the core of their proposition. Prepare examples from your past experiences where you’ve prioritised client needs or gone the extra mile for customer satisfaction. This will highlight your alignment with their values and your potential fit within their team.
✨Prepare Thoughtful Questions
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are insightful questions about the company’s approach to wealth management, their growth strategy, or how they support their financial planners.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you.
